Manufacturing Manager & Product Designer Jobs in Danielson, CT at Sports Equipment Manufacturer
** Pay commensurate with related experience **
We are a growing sport equipment manufacturer seeking a proactive manufacturing professional for product design and execution in manufacturing. They will be a highly motivated individual who will be productive within a CNC-driven wood, carpentry, resin, paint & metal fabrication environment. This role is hands-on with everything from CAD modeling and CNC programming, to process development and production launch.
The ideal candidate thrives in a fast-moving environment and is comfortable moving between design workstation and shop floor daily.
